[ ] Hot-reload check (Vexbridge config daemon). Before sign-off: touch the staging config, confirm the daemon picks it up within 5s without restart, verify no dropped connections in the Orlet gateway, and confirm stale values are evicted from the cache tier. If reload fails, do not force-push a restart — page the duty lead. Record the build token printed below.

pipeline stamp: htk21_0e1a1ddcdb5bfd88d6dd6

**Runbook: Slow autocomplete on Findlet**

If customers report sluggish suggestions, first check the Findlet index lag dashboard. Lag above 30 seconds usually means the suggester shards on the Norwick cluster are rebuilding. Do not restart the cluster; instead, trigger a warm-cache pass via the admin endpoint, which typically restores response times within five minutes. The warm-cache call requires authentication against the Torchline internal gateway. Use the shared support account, and pass the key below in the request header.

service key, fawip-bajef: kto11_Qt5wZK9vdNC

# Break-Glass: Catalog Cache Invalidation

Scope: the Pinrow product catalog at Veldstone Retail. If stale prices persist after a purge and the Hollowmere invalidation queue is wedged, use break-glass to flush the edge tier directly. Contractors: get verbal sign-off from the catalog lead first. Steps: open the Hollowmere admin shell, select emergency-flush, confirm the tenant, and run it once — repeated flushes thrash the origin. Access is logged and expires after 20 minutes. Unseal the admin shell with the passphrase below.

recovery phrase for kahop-tajog: istix-casvan

Handover note — Crumbwheel order cutoffs.

Welcome aboard. The bakery cutoff rule in Crumbwheel closes same-day orders at 14:00 local to each storefront, not UTC — this has bitten us twice. Holiday overrides live in the calendar service and take precedence silently, so always check there first when a cutoff looks wrong. To unlock the calendar service's admin console after a restart, enter the recovery passphrase below.

vault phrase of bagap-bahaf = silion-pelox-sorox-casdor-quenwyn-fraax-eliox-praael-kelion-quenvan-kasox-rusael-norius-belvan